Internal Memo — Pilot Programme Churn

Team, a quick word on the Greenhollow loyalty pilot: churn in the first eight weeks hit 22%, well above what we modelled. Exit surveys point to confusing reward tiers rather than pricing, which is fixable. We're simplifying the scheme to two tiers and extending the pilot by a month. Please brief your floor staff but keep the numbers in-house. The pilot's fate feeds directly into the following.

confidential, yagep-kagef: Rusvanox Holdings is in early talks to buy Julwynix Systems for about $454.5 million. The Fenael launch date is April 23, and nothing goes to the press before then. Legal wants the Druwynix Works term sheet redrafted before January 8.

New hires often ask how residents open a Tumblebin laundry locker. The flow: the mobile app requests a short-lived unlock token from the Lockgrid service, which validates the resident's active reservation before signing it. The locker firmware checks the signature offline, so tokens work even during network blips — but they expire after five minutes, which explains most support tickets. Token format, reservation edge cases, and the firmware compatibility matrix are all documented on the internal page linked below.

dashboard of hadug-fawep = https://artifactory.braskhq.test/deploy

## TICKET-4471: Websocket reconnects broken on staging (config drift)

Hey — the Murmuration chat gateway on staging keeps dropping websocket clients and never reconnecting. Turns out staging drifted from prod sometime last month; someone hand-edited the reconnect backoff settings and they never got committed. Please realign staging with the values below, which reflect what production is actually running.

deployment values, yahag-tawef:
ZORWYN_HOST=zorwyn.tolvaqlabs.internal
ZORWYN_PORT=9300

Runbook: Cron drift on the Tidemark scheduler. If jobs fire late by more than 90 seconds, first confirm NTP sync on the quarryhost nodes, then compare the drift metric in the Ledgeview dashboard against the last deploy timestamp. To pull drift history, the probe script needs its .env populated: set PROBE_INTERVAL and TARGET_HOST per the sample, then add the metrics API token on the following line.

sealed setting: VAULT_KEY20=c8ea1e419912889df6b4